What is a Part Time Power BI job?

A Part Time Power BI job involves using Microsoft's Power BI platform to analyze data, create reports, and develop dashboards, typically on a limited-hour basis. Professionals in this role help businesses gain insights from data while working flexible schedules. Responsibilities may include data modeling, visualization, and collaboration with teams to support decision-making. These roles are ideal for freelancers, remote workers, or those seeking supplemental income.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Part Time Power Bi position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Power BI professional, you need a solid understanding of data analysis, visualization techniques, and experience using Microsoft Power BI for reporting. Familiarity with DAX, SQL, Excel, and sometimes a certification in Power BI or data visualization tools is highly beneficial. Strong communication, problem-solving sk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ities efficiently help you stand out in this role. These abilities ensure you can effectively transform data into actionable insights and support business decision-making, even within a part-time schedule.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as a part-time Power BI professional?

As a part-time Power BI specialist, you’ll typically work on designing dashboards, creating visual reports, and interpreting complex datasets to produce actionable insights for your team or clients. Your responsibilities may include meeting with stakeholders to understand their reporting requirements, cleaning and merging data from multiple sources, and delivering periodic business intelligence updates. You may collaborate closely with departments like sales, finance, or operations to tailor solutions that address their data needs. While part-time hours provide flexibility, you’ll still play a crucial role in driving data-informed decisions through clear and insightful reporting.

The Team

We are seeking a Power Platform Product Owner at the Manager level to support the design, delivery, and ongoing ownership of internal Power Platform solutions. This role partners with internal business stakeholders to translate operational needs into scalable, well‑governed Power Platform applications and automations. The ideal candidate combines strong stakeholder communication skills, hands‑on low‑code development experience, and Power Platform environment administration knowledge. This role supports a portfolio of production internal applications and workflows critical to day‑to‑day operations.

How you will contribute:

Key Responsibilities

Product Ownership & Stakeholder Engagement

  • Act as primary point of contact for internal stakeholders for assigned Power Platform solutions.
  • Lead requirements gathering, solution design discussions, and backlog prioritization.
  • Translate business needs into user stories, functional designs, and delivery plans.
  • Provide clear project updates, including scope, status, risks, and dependencies.

Solution Design & Development

  • Design, build, and enhance internal solutions using:
    • Power Apps
    • Power Automate
    • Power BI
    • Dataverse
  • Execute complex builds and automation work independently.
  • Apply strong data modeling and solution design principles.
  • Ensure solutions are scalable, maintainable, and aligned with internal standards.

Platform Administration & Governance

  • Support Power Platform environment administration, including:
    • Environment setup and management
    • Security roles and access controls
    • Connections, connection references, and solution packaging
  • Participate in application lifecycle management, deployments, and releases.
  • Ensure adherence to governance, documentation, and operational standards.

Quality & Team Enablement

  • Ensure quality, consistency, and timeliness of deliverables.
  • Review work completed by junior team members and provide guidance.
  • Act as an escalation point for solution or delivery issues

Continuous Improvement

  • Stay current with Microsoft Power Platform features and release updates.
  • Identify opportunities to improve, standardize, and scale internal solutions.

Qualifications:

Required

  • Hands‑on experience with Power Apps, Power Automate, and Power BI.
  • Strong understanding of data modeling and solution design.
  • Experience translating business requirements into technical solutions.
  • Proven ability to communicate effectively with non‑technical stakeholders.
  • Familiarity with Power Platform environments, solution management, and governance concepts.

Preferred

  • Experience supporting production internal applications and automations.
  • Exposure to Power Platform ALM and deployment practices.
  • Experience with internal operations or tax technology solutions.
  • Demonstrated interest in platform standardization and scalable design.
